Northern Plains Stone Head War Club c. Mid 1900s
For your consideration is this Native American stone head war club from the Northern Plains region circa mid 1900s. This club shows a hand carved hard stone head held onto the haft with a wrap of parfleche rawhide. The haft is wrapped in tanned rawhide showing a cross style wrap. The piece does not appear to have been made for ceremonial use as it is not decorated and is made with a hard stone, but most likely was made for personal protection on the Plains and hard life in the early Reservation period directly post Indian Wars. The club measures 17 3/4" in length and 6 5/8" in width at the head of the club. It weighs 2 pounds and 12 ounces.
